2. Challenges Of Reusing Solar Panels
It is commonly approved that reusing solar panels has many environmental benefits, nonetheless, it is likewise true that the procedure isn't without its challenges. Yet exactly what are these difficulties? Allow's explore further.
Among the most significant issues with recycling photovoltaic panels is the complexity of the job itself. It can be challenging to break down the various components, such as glass and steel, to be recycled independently. Additionally, photovoltaic panel producers typically have a mix of products used in their items which makes sorting them even more difficult. In addition, there are safety and health and wellness threats included with taking care of busted glass or breathing in fumes from thawing parts.
An additional key obstacle associated with reusing solar panels is expense. Several countries do not have enough infrastructure or sources to properly recycle these things which results in higher expenditures for services attempting to do so. Additionally, as a result of the specific nature of reusing photovoltaic panels, this can develop an economic worry on business trying to stay compliant with laws. Eventually, these expenses could be passed down to customers making it hard for them to pay for renewable energy sources.

3. Strategies For Recycling Solar Panels
As the globe pursues a more lasting future, recycling solar panels is an increasingly popular job. Amidst this growing rate of interest, nonetheless, we must think about the techniques that remain in location to make it possible.
To start with, lots of companies have carried out a 'take-back' system where old or broken photovoltaic panels can be collected and sent out to their corresponding factories for recycling. This way, the materials have the ability to be reused in the construction of new products. In addition, some communities have even begun offering rewards for people wanting to reuse their photovoltaic panels; this could range from tax obligation breaks to free shipping prices.
Furthermore, modern technology has become progressively advanced when it involves reusing photovoltaic panels-- with specialist machines capable of separating out all the different components within them. For example, by using AI-powered robotic arms, these devices can draw out helpful products such as copper and aluminium while likewise taking care of contaminated materials securely. Because of this, this procedure is both time and budget-friendly-- enabling us to make better use of our sources whilst maintaining our atmosphere tidy.
